A simple digital clock for iLiad
************************************************** *******************
Preparation:
[1] Extract directory "gtkclock.install" from zip-file to CF/MMC/SD
Please dont' use iLiad's Main Memory.
[2] Insert memory card into iLiad, if you used one in previous step
Installation:
[1] Search for "Install Simple Digital Clock" in Contentlister
[2] Click on this entry to install app
[3] This takes a while. Blinking of LED stops when finished, you will get a "Installed message"
Usage:
[1 ] Go to the progams folder
[2] Load the clock with the entry "Simple Digital Clock"
you can choose between top left and top right position
[2] Click with stylus on the "Quit Simple Digital Clock" to exit programm

Ok, one of GTK+ clocks I have tried so far is running. It's the digital clock gtkclock. 120 lines of source code or so.
The main crux I have noticed iLiad's pdf viewer ipdf lays above all windowed apps therefore they get "invisible". I have to click on the last known position of gtkclock then it get's "visible" again. Interesting the "dialog-hint bar" with x-button is gone.
This 1-update-per-second makes me nervous. But tweaking
Code:
g_timeout_add(1000, (GSourceFunc) clock_update, (gpointer) &d);
should solve this. Still some work to do. I'm working on port of an analogue clock, too.
Another problem: iLiad's time zone from iDS isn't the correct local time. It's not fair to say to Average Joe: set time with command date. Scotty1024 has posted a time zone switcher long time ago.

Application Options:
-F, --font=FN font (fontconfig) to be used
-f, --foreground=FG foreground color
-b, --background=BG background color
-t, --format=FORMAT time format (strftime format string)
